ABSTRACT

Objective To explore the effect of gliclazide and Sig Leo Dean on insulin treatment for poor glycemic control in obese patients with type 2 diabetes mellitus. Methods 80 cases of insulin treatment for poor glycemic control in obese patients with type 2 diabetes mellitus treated in our hospital from March 2015 to January 2017 were randomly divided into two groups,with 40 cases in each group.The control group was treated with gliclazide The observation group was treated with Sig Leo Dean.The therapeutic effects of the two groups were observed and compared. Results 2 hours postprandial blood glucose levels improved in the observation group was better than that of the control group, the body weight, blood pressure, fasting blood glucose of two groups were improved, and there were no significant difference between the two groups; The incidence rate of adverse reactions was 2.5% in the observation group, 10% in the control group, the difference was not statistically significant (P<0.05). Conclusion Analysis of gliclazide and Sig Leo Dean on insulin treatment for poor glycemic control in obese patients with type 2 diabetes mellitus curative effect, Sig Leo Dean for the glycaemic improvement effect is higher, reduce the incidence of adverse reactions, so more medication safety, it is worthy of clinical promotion Application.

ABSTRACT

Objective To investigate the application value of Tangniaole capsule combined with metformin in patients with newly diagnosed type 2 diabetes mellitus (T2DM).Methods 120 cases of patients with newly diagnosed T2DM were divided into the control group and the observation group.The control group was treated with metformin while the observation group was additionally treated with Tangniaole capsule.Symptoms and signs, changes in blood glucose, urine glucose, insulin resistance index (HOMA-IR) and insulin secretion (HOMA-β) were compared between the two groups.The incidence of adverse reactions was statistically analyzed.Results The curative effect in the observation group was better than control group (P<0.05).After treatment, scores of symptoms and signs, blood glucose, glycosylated hemoglobin (HbA1c), 24 h urine glucose quantitation and HOMA-IR were lower, and HOMA-β was higher in the observation group than in the control group (P<0.05).Conclusion Tangniaole capsule combined with metformin is effective in the treatment of newly diagnosed T2DM, and it can reduce blood glucose, urine glucose and insulin resistance.

ABSTRACT

Objective To study the analysis of insulin glargine combined with acarbose in type 2 diabetes compared with pre mixed insulin treatment efficacy and safety. Methods 100 patients with type 2 diabetes mellitus treated in our hospital from March 2015 to August 2016 were selected and randomly divided into the control group and the experimental group, with 50 patients in each group. The control group were treated with premixed insulin treatment, the experimental group were treated with basal insulin combined with acarbose. The clinical indexes of the experimental group and the control group were compared and analyzed. Results After the corresponding treatment, the fasting blood glucose level of the control group was (7.56 ± 1.13) nmol / L, and the fasting blood glucose level of the experimental group was (7.01 ± 0.92) nmol / L. The level of fasting blood glucose in the experimental group was significantly lower than that in the control group, with statistical difference (P<0.05). The level of HbA1c in the experimental group was (7.01 ± 0.82)%, significantly lower than that in the control group, and the level of HbA1c (7.45 ± 0.91)%, with statistical difference (P<0.05). Among the 50 patients in the control group, hypoglycemia occurred in 20 patients, the incidence of hypoglycemia was 40%, significantly higher than that in the experimental group, and the incidence of hypoglycemia was 14%, which was statistically significant (P<0.05). Conclusion Basal insulin combined with acarbose compared with premixed insulin treatment of type 2 diabetes treatment can significantly hypoglycemic effect, high safety, with further clinical promotion and application significance.
